Team — the Wrenshelf catalogue import for the Dunmarsh branch completed tonight. 48k records in, 312 skipped for malformed call numbers; skip report attached to the release page. Support: if patrons report missing titles, check the skip report before filing anything. Re-import is scheduled for next week after the mapping fix lands. No action needed otherwise. Reference this import in tickets using the build token below.

pipeline stamp: htk21_86b657ac0aa916a9af17f

The KioskKeeper watchdog restarts the Wrenfield lobby app when heartbeats stall. To avoid restart storms during network blips, we apply exponential backoff with a hard ceiling, and a cooldown window suppresses alerts for transient flaps. Release manager note: these values ship baked into the image and cannot be hot-patched. The values slated for the next release are as follows.

constants for tageg-kagag:
QUOTAS = {
    "kelax": 495,
    "istath": 366,
    "tammir": 108,
    "novdor": 730,
    "casax": 816,
    "quenael": 874,
    "pelius": 403,
}

Capacity Call: Tornby Plant (Managers Only)

Welcome aboard! Quick context: we've decided to hold Tornby at current output rather than add a fourth shift, at least until the Quillar line demand firms up. Maintenance windows get easier, margins stay healthier. Full modelling is linked on the sidebar. The confidential rationale sits just below.

internal memo for hahif-hahaf: Headcount on the Zorwyn team goes from 9 to 100 by the end of October. Gross margin on Zorwyn came in at 5 percent against a plan of 10 percent.

Ticket: Staging env misconfigured for Siftgate bloom filter

The bloom layer in front of the Pellet KV store is rejecting all lookups in staging because the env file was copied from the dev template without credentials. False-positive tuning values are fine; only the auth line is missing. To unblock the weekly demo, the Pellet admission secret must be set on the following line.

env line for yaguf-fajop: LEDGER_TOKEN13=fb08984397349